    Performance and Powertrain

    When we talk about the performance of the 1993 Cadillac Fleetwood Brougham, we're talking about smooth, effortless power. Under the hood, you'll typically find a 5.7-liter V8 engine, delivering ample torque for comfortable cruising and confident acceleration. This engine isn't about raw speed; it's about providing a refined and relaxed driving experience. The engine is paired with a smooth-shifting automatic transmission, further enhancing the car's effortless performance. The powertrain is designed to deliver a seamless and comfortable ride, making the Fleetwood Brougham an ideal car for long journeys. The V8 engine provides plenty of power for overtaking and merging onto highways, while the automatic transmission ensures that gear changes are smooth and unobtrusive. The car's suspension is tuned for comfort, absorbing bumps and imperfections in the road to provide a smooth and stable ride.
